在日常办公和数据分析工作中,Excel几乎成为不可或缺的工具。“Excel如何设置高级筛选数据库?”是许多数据管理者和分析师常见的操作难题。相比普通筛选,高级筛选不仅能根据复杂条件筛选数据,还能实现复制结果、跨表筛选等功能,大大提升数据处理效率。让我们从原理和实际应用场景入手,深度解读 Excel 高级筛选数据库的实用价值。
一、Excel高级筛选数据库基础解析:原理与应用场景
1、Excel高级筛选的原理是什么?
Excel高级筛选基于“条件区域”和“数据库区域”的交互,允许用户设置多种筛选条件,并将结果输出到指定区域。这种筛选方式特别适合:
- 需要多条件组合筛选
- 希望筛选结果单独输出
- 批量处理大规模数据表
与普通筛选不同,高级筛选不依赖表头下拉菜单,而是通过设置条件区域,灵活控制筛选逻辑。
核心原理:
- 数据区域:包含需要筛选的全部数据,通常含有标题行。
- 条件区域:用户自定义的条件表,需与数据区域标题完全一致。
- 输出区域(可选):决定筛选结果是否复制到新位置。
例如,若有如下员工信息表:
| 姓名 | 部门 | 岗位 | 工龄 | 薪资 |
|---|---|---|---|---|
| 张三 | 销售 | 主管 | 5 | 8000 |
| 李四 | 技术 | 工程师 | 3 | 10000 |
| 王五 | 销售 | 员工 | 2 | 6000 |
| 赵六 | 技术 | 主管 | 6 | 12000 |
你可以通过高级筛选,快速筛选出技术部门主管,或工龄大于3年的员工等。
2、高级筛选适用场景对比
普通筛选 VS 高级筛选:
| 功能 | 普通筛选 | 高级筛选 |
|---|---|---|
| 单一条件筛选 | 支持 | 支持 |
| 多条件组合筛选 | 不支持 | 支持 |
| 跨表筛选 | 不支持 | 支持 |
| 输出到新区域 | 不支持 | 支持 |
| 复杂逻辑筛选 | 不便实现 | 灵活实现 |
适合场景举例:
- 人力资源:多条件筛选候选人(如学历+工龄+部门)
- 销售统计:筛选特定时间段内多区域销售数据
- 财务分析:按照多项财务指标筛选异常数据
结论:如需处理复杂筛选需求,建议优先使用 Excel 高级筛选数据库功能。
3、数据库式数据管理的优势
数据库筛选是指将 Excel 表格当作数据库操作,支持高度定制化的数据抽取和分析。优势包括:
- 一次性处理大量数据
- 条件灵活,可多层嵌套
- 输出可复用,便于后续统计
许多企业已经将 Excel 作为轻量级数据库使用,但如果希望更高效地进行在线数据填报、自动审批、数据统计,还可尝试如简道云这样的零代码数字化平台。简道云由IDC认证为国内市占率第一,拥有超2千万用户和20万团队,能替代 Excel 实现更高效的在线数据管理。感兴趣可在线试用: 简道云在线试用:www.jiandaoyun.com 。
二、Excel高级筛选数据库详细步骤解析(图文+案例)
真正掌握“Excel如何设置高级筛选数据库?详细图文步骤教你轻松掌握”,关键在于理解每一步的操作细节和背后逻辑。以下将以实际案例为基础,详细拆解操作流程,并通过表格、步骤总结和实用技巧,助你轻松实现复杂筛选。
1、准备数据区域与条件区域
步骤一:整理数据区域
- 数据区域需包含标题行,内容整齐。
- 举例:员工信息表
| 姓名 | 部门 | 岗位 | 工龄 | 薪资 |
|---|---|---|---|---|
| 张三 | 销售 | 主管 | 5 | 8000 |
| 李四 | 技术 | 工程师 | 3 | 10000 |
| 王五 | 销售 | 员工 | 2 | 6000 |
| 赵六 | 技术 | 主管 | 6 | 12000 |
步骤二:设置条件区域
- 条件区域标题需与数据区完全一致
- 在数据表旁边新建条件区域
| 部门 | 岗位 | 工龄 |
|---|---|---|
| 技术 | 主管 | >3 |
条件区域可设置多行,每行代表一个“或”条件,同一行则为“且”关系。
2、Excel高级筛选具体操作流程
步骤三:打开高级筛选面板
- 选中数据区域(含标题行)
- 点击“数据”选项卡,找到“高级”按钮
- 弹出“高级筛选”对话框
步骤四:填写筛选参数
- 列表区域:输入数据区域地址(如:A1:E5)
- 条件区域:输入条件区域地址(如:G1:I2)
- 复制到其他位置:如需输出到新区域,勾选此项,并填写输出区域地址
步骤五:确认筛选并查看结果
- 点击“确定”,结果即显示在原表或新区域
图文步骤总结:
- 选中数据区域 → 数据 → 高级
- 填写列表区域、条件区域
- 选择输出方式
- 确认筛选,结果即时呈现 🎉
3、常见高级筛选数据库案例
案例一:多条件“且”筛选
筛选技术部门,岗位为主管,工龄大于3年。
| 部门 | 岗位 | 工龄 |
|---|---|---|
| 技术 | 主管 | >3 |
筛选后结果:
| 姓名 | 部门 | 岗位 | 工龄 | 薪资 |
|---|---|---|---|---|
| 赵六 | 技术 | 主管 | 6 | 12000 |
案例二:多条件“或”筛选
筛选技术主管或销售主管:
| 部门 | 岗位 |
|---|---|
| 技术 | 主管 |
| 销售 | 主管 |
筛选结果:
| 姓名 | 部门 | 岗位 | 工龄 | 薪资 |
|---|---|---|---|---|
| 张三 | 销售 | 主管 | 5 | 8000 |
| 赵六 | 技术 | 主管 | 6 | 12000 |
案例三:跨表筛选和结果复制
- 将筛选结果复制到新表,便于后续统计和报告。
4、高级筛选实用技巧与注意事项
- 条件区域标题必须与数据区域标题完全一致,否则筛选无效
- 支持文本、数字、公式等多种筛选条件
- 可通过公式实现更复杂筛选,如“=A2>10000”
- 筛选结果可跨表输出,方便数据整理
- 多条件“或”需分行,“且”同一行填写
小贴士:如需批量处理和自动化数据流转,建议尝试用简道云进行替代,支持在线填报、流程审批和统计分析,效率远超传统Excel。 简道云在线试用:www.jiandaoyun.com
三、Excel高级筛选数据库的提升实践与扩展思路
理解了“Excel如何设置高级筛选数据库?详细图文步骤教你轻松掌握”的操作流程后,实际工作中还需考虑数据安全性、效率优化和跨团队协作等问题。下面围绕提升实践和扩展应用,提供更深层次的思路和解决方案。
1、高级筛选数据库的效率优化
Excel高级筛选数据库虽强大,但在数据量巨大或多团队协作时,仍有局限性。如何提升效率?
- 批量数据处理时,建议提前规范数据区域格式,减少筛选错误
- 对于多条件复杂筛选,可将条件区域预设为模板,便于复用
- 利用Excel宏(VBA)自动化筛选流程,提升操作效率
- 定期备份筛选结果,防止数据丢失
效率对比:
| 操作方式 | 单次处理 | 批量处理 | 自动化 |
|---|---|---|---|
| 普通筛选 | 快速 | 繁琐 | 不支持 |
| 高级筛选 | 灵活 | 较快 | 支持宏 |
| 简道云替代 | 极速 | 高效 | 全自动 |
2、高级筛选数据库的安全与协作
- Excel本地数据安全风险较高,建议定期加密、备份
- 跨部门协作时,易出现版本混乱、数据丢失
- 在线数据管理平台如简道云,支持多团队协作、权限分配和自动化审批,安全性和协同效率更高
团队协作方案:
- Excel本地协作:需频繁邮件传输,版本管理难
- 简道云在线协作:云端实时同步,权限灵活分配,团队效率提升
简道云不仅能替代 Excel 实现更高效的数据管理,还能通过零代码方式,轻松搭建数据填报、流程审批、统计分析等场景。国内市场占有率第一,2千万+用户和20万+团队已验证。体验在线试用: 简道云在线试用:www.jiandaoyun.com
3、扩展:从Excel到在线数字化平台的转型
在数字化转型浪潮下,越来越多企业开始由传统 Excel 管理,转向云端平台。Excel高级筛选数据库虽然强大,但面对在线填报、自动审批、大数据分析等需求,平台化工具更具优势。
- 数据实时更新,协作无障碍
- 自动化流程,减少人工干预
- 多维度统计分析,决策更高效
未来发展趋势:
- Excel高级筛选数据库作为基础工具,适合个人或小团队
- 企业级数据管理建议转向简道云等零代码平台,实现智能化、自动化数据流转
四、全文概括与简道云推荐
本文围绕“Excel如何设置高级筛选数据库?详细图文步骤教你轻松掌握”主题,系统讲解了Excel高级筛选数据库的原理、应用场景、详细操作步骤和实用技巧,并结合案例、表格和数据对比,帮助你真正理解并高效解决复杂筛选问题。无论是个人数据处理,还是团队协作、批量数据分析,掌握高级筛选技巧都能显著提升工作效率。
同时,面对更复杂的数据填报与流程管理需求,推荐你尝试简道云——IDC认证国内市场占有率第一的零代码数字化平台。简道云拥有2千万+用户和20万+团队,能完全替代excel进行在线数据填报、流程审批、统计分析等场景,协作更高效、数据更安全。立即体验: 简道云在线试用:www.jiandaoyun.com
掌握Excel高级筛选数据库,轻松解决复杂筛选难题——数字化转型,简道云为你保驾护航! 🚀
本文相关FAQs
1. Excel高级筛选和普通筛选有什么区别?应用场景分别有哪些?
很多人用Excel筛选数据时都习惯点一下“筛选”按钮,但听说过“高级筛选”的功能后,或许会有点困惑:这俩到底有啥不同?实际工作里应该怎么选用?能不能举点例子说明下?
嗨,这个问题我当时也是琢磨了好久。简单讲,普通筛选适合日常快速过滤,比如你想筛某一列里所有“已完成”状态的项目,点击筛选就能搞定。但高级筛选就厉害了,能基于多字段、复杂条件甚至跨表筛选,非常适合数据分析和报表场景。
- 普通筛选:
- 只支持对单一表格直接操作,筛选条件较为简单,比如“等于”、“大于”等。
- 操作门槛低,随手点一下就能用。
- 不能实现“或”关系筛选,比如要同时筛出“销售部”和“市场部”员工,普通筛选要点两次,效率不高。
- 高级筛选:
- 支持多条件和复杂逻辑,像“部门=销售部或市场部,并且业绩大于100万”,直接能一次筛出来。
- 可以把筛选结果复制到新位置,不影响原数据。
- 能用“公式”进行筛选,比如筛选出“本月生日”的员工。
应用场景举个例子:普通筛选适合日常查找,高级筛选适合做月度汇总、数据分析甚至自动化报表。比如公司HR想筛出所有入职时间在2023年且岗位为“经理”的名单,这时候高级筛选一把梭,效率高还不容易漏。
如果你经常需要复杂条件筛选,建议多练练高级筛选,尤其是配合“条件区域”用法,工作效率能翻倍。有兴趣可以试试简道云,数据筛选和管理更灵活: 简道云在线试用:www.jiandaoyun.com 。
2. Excel高级筛选“条件区域”怎么设置?常见的坑有哪些?
刚开始用高级筛选时,条件区域总是搞不明白。比如到底要不要包含表头?条件区域和数据区域不能重叠吗?实际设置时有哪些容易踩的坑?有没有什么实用的小技巧分享?
哈,条件区域确实是高级筛选的精髓,但容易出错。我的经验总结如下:
- 条件区域必须包含字段名(和数据表字段一模一样),比如你表里是“姓名”,条件区域也得叫“姓名”。
- 条件区域可以放在数据表外的任意位置,只要不和数据区域重合,避免筛选出错。
- 多条件筛选时,条件区域每一行代表“或”关系,同一行多个字段代表“且”关系。
- 记得条件区域不要留空行,否则会导致筛选结果异常。
- 条件区域的字段顺序可以和数据区域不同,但字段名必须一致。
举个常见的坑:如果条件区域字段名写错,比如把“部门”写成“部门名称”,Excel就识别不了,会筛不出结果。还有一种情况,条件区域和数据区域重叠了,筛选结果会覆盖原数据,非常尴尬。
小技巧:可以把条件区域单独放在表的右侧或下方,并用边框标记出来,方便管理和后续修改。
如果还遇到奇怪的筛选结果,建议检查下条件区域是否有隐藏字符或者多余空格。掌握这些细节,高级筛选会顺畅很多!
3. 如何用Excel高级筛选实现“多表数据合并”?有没有推荐的操作流程?
实际工作中经常遇到需要把不同部门、不同来源的数据合并分析,但Excel自带的高级筛选好像只能筛选单表数据。如果想用高级筛选做多表合并处理,有什么操作心得或者变通方法?
嘿,这个场景超级常见!Excel高级筛选确实原生只支持单表数据,但也有办法灵活处理。我的经验如下:
- 先把多个表的数据用“复制粘贴”合并到同一个工作表里,确保表头一致(比如所有表都叫“部门”、“姓名”、“业绩”)。
- 用“高级筛选”设置条件区域,比如筛选“销售部”的所有数据。
- 如果数据量大或来源多,可以用“数据透视表”辅助合并,筛选后再做数据清洗。
- 遇到表头格式不一致时,建议统一字段名和顺序,否则筛选容易出错。
- 合并后用高级筛选提取需要的数据,比如“去年业绩大于100万的员工”,一键筛出。
如果需要动态合并和筛选,Excel可能有点吃力,这时候可以考虑用简道云这类在线数据平台,能跨表管理和筛选,效率高不少: 简道云在线试用:www.jiandaoyun.com 。
掌握这个流程后,多表合并分析就不是难题啦!
4. Excel高级筛选能否实现“模糊查询”?比如只输入一部分关键词就能筛出对应数据?
日常用Excel查找数据时,经常遇到只记得员工姓名的一部分,或者客户编号只有前几位,能不能用高级筛选做“模糊查询”?具体操作有没有什么限制或者注意事项?
你好,这问题我也是实际工作中碰到的。Excel高级筛选本身支持模糊查询,关键是学会用“通配符”。比如:
- 用“”代表任意字符,比如条件区域填写“张”,就能筛出所有姓张的人:“张三”“张小明”等。
- 用“?”代表单个字符,比如“张?”能筛出“张三”“张四”等。
- 在条件区域设置字段为“姓名”,值填“明”,就能查出所有名字中带“明”的员工。
注意事项:
- 通配符只能用在文本字段,不适用于数字。
- 条件区域填写时,通配符不能和公式混用,否则会筛选失败。
- 如果字段里有空格或特殊字符,建议先清洗数据,以防筛选遗漏。
模糊查询用好了,Excel筛选能力可以媲美数据库。如果遇到更复杂的筛选需求,比如跨表模糊检索,可以考虑配合VLOOKUP或在线数据工具提升效率。
5. Excel高级筛选结果如何自动更新?有没有办法实现动态筛选?
很多时候,数据表会不断新增或修改内容,但用高级筛选筛一次后,数据更新了筛选结果不会自动刷新。有没有什么办法让高级筛选结果动态更新?有没有实用的自动化技巧?
嗨,这个困扰我很久了!Excel高级筛选本身是一次性操作,数据变了需要手动重新筛选。但我总结了一些实用方法:
- 用Excel“表格”功能(Ctrl+T),把数据区域设为表格,新增数据会自动包含在表格范围内。
- 设置好条件区域后,可以录制一个简单的宏,把筛选步骤自动化,每次数据更新后“一键刷新”筛选结果。
- 用“数据透视表”实现动态筛选和汇总,数据变动后只需点击刷新按钮,结果就自动更新。
- 如果需要定时自动更新,可用“Power Query”把数据连接到数据源,筛选逻辑写进Query,每次刷新都能同步最新数据。
当然,如果追求更高效的数据自动化,像简道云这类平台支持表单数据自动筛选和同步,适合团队协作和动态分析: 简道云在线试用:www.jiandaoyun.com 。
有了这些技巧,高级筛选就能“自动化”不少,工作效率大提升!如果你有特殊业务场景,也欢迎留言一起讨论更好的解决方案。

